There are several effective Christian self-help apps and digital tools designed to support your spiritual growth and daily habits.
A primary recommendation is the YouVersion Bible App, which is a free resource offering daily plans and devotionals to deepen your prayer life and discipleship.
Another top interactive tool is d365, provided by BuildFaith. This app-based resource offers daily practices for all ages, helping users build spiritual discipline through scripture and prayer.
